Ricoh GR III Street Edition Compact Digital Camera Now Available as a Standalone Product

Back in June this year Ricoh has introduced the GR III Street Edition compact digital camera, but with an accessory kit. Now things have been changed, the Ricoh GR III Street Edition is now available as a standalone product, rather than a camera kit with a viewfinder and genuine leather strap.

The GR III Street Edition has a 24.2MP APS-C CMOS sensor, GR Engine 6, unique surface texture, which is achieved by a multi-layer spray process that provides a smooth-but-non-slippery feel. It has a striking yellow-orange accent color ring cap on the external viewfinder, and a leather hand strap. A shutdown screen featuring a specially designed product logo and a street-view image that symbolizes the camera’s “street snapshot” concept.

Additionally, the GR III Street Edition also includes the Full Press Snap feature, which lets you instantly shift the focus point of the lens to a preselected position when the shutter release button is fully pressed. This function can also be assigned to the rear LCD, where you simply tap the touch screen to quickly change focus and ignore the standard AF process, to help intuitively capture fleeting moments.
